Team — flagging for the weekly sync. The Marrowfield inventory reconciliation job has been drifting: runtime up from 20 min to 70 min over three weeks, and it missed its SLA twice. Root cause looks like unindexed joins on the new warehouse table, but not confirmed. On-call should not restart mid-run; partial reconciles corrupt counts and need manual rollback. I've written up symptoms, safe-abort steps, and the runtime graph. Please review before Thursday. Everything is collected on the page below.

operations page: https://vault.qorvelcorp.example/settings

**Handover: Lanternfold API pagination**

Handing off the pagination work on the Lanternfold public REST API. Cursor tokens are opaque, signed, and expire after 15 minutes; offset-based access was removed last quarter. The security-relevant bits are token signing and replay windows. Full threat notes and the signing design are documented on the internal page below.

wiki page, tahaf-tajog: https://jira.ordindyn.corp/pipeline

# CrashFunnel Environments

Welcome aboard! CrashFunnel is the pipeline that ingests crash reports from the Lumawave mobile apps and batches them into the triage queue. We run three environments: dev, staging, and prod. Dev is fair game for experiments; staging mirrors prod symbol files, so don't clear its cache without pinging the team. Prod deploys only go out Tuesdays. For local setup, point your agent at staging using the values below.

settings of tagef-bawif:
DRUIX_HOST=druix.zemvarlabs.internal
DRUIX_PORT=8000

MEMO — Office Manager

Trophies for the Larkspell awards night are back from Emberline Engraving. Check all fourteen nameplates against the winners list before boxing — last year two were swapped. Box individually, bubble wrap, no stacking. Courier pickup is Thursday at four for delivery to the Fennick Hall venue. Keep the spare blank plate here. The courier hand-over instruction follows below.

handover note for yagef-bagep: the drudor pelius courier leaves the kasdor zorvan norir ledger at gate 8016 under passcode 755406